Understanding Digital Document Signatures
Digital document signatures represent a technological evolution from traditional handwritten signatures, offering a more secure, efficient way to authenticate documents. Unlike simple electronic signatures, which can be as basic as a typed name or scanned image, digital signatures use advanced cryptographic techniques to verify the signer’s identity and ensure document integrity. This distinction is particularly important for Houston businesses operating in regulated industries where proof of authenticity and non-repudiation are essential compliance requirements. Blockchain technology is increasingly being integrated with digital signature solutions to provide an immutable record of signed documents.
- Public Key Infrastructure (PKI): The foundation of digital signatures, using cryptographic key pairs to create a secure, verifiable signature that can’t be forged.
- Certificate Authorities (CAs): Trusted third parties that issue digital certificates verifying the identity of the signer, essential for establishing trust in the signature process.
- Cryptographic Hash Functions: Mathematical algorithms that create a unique digital fingerprint of the document, ensuring it hasn’t been altered after signing.
- Timestamp Services: Independent verification of when a document was signed, providing an additional layer of authentication and non-repudiation.
- Audit Trails: Comprehensive logs documenting each step of the signature process, critical for compliance and forensic analysis in case of disputes.

Security Features and Compliance Requirements
For Houston businesses, particularly those in regulated industries, the security features of digital signature solutions represent a critical consideration. These capabilities not only protect sensitive information but also ensure compliance with industry-specific regulations and standards. The technology employs multiple layers of security that work together to create a comprehensive protective framework. Understanding these features and how they address compliance requirements is essential for IT security professionals implementing digital signature solutions in Houston’s business environment, where data privacy principles are increasingly scrutinized.
- Signer Authentication: Multi-factor authentication options verify signer identity through methods such as email verification, SMS codes, knowledge-based questions, or biometric verification.
- Document Encryption: End-to-end encryption protects document contents during transmission and storage, addressing data security requirements for Houston’s healthcare and energy sectors.
- Tamper-Evident Seals: Cryptographic technology that immediately reveals if a document has been modified after signing, maintaining evidence integrity.
- Comprehensive Audit Trails: Detailed records of all document activities, including who accessed it, when it was signed, and from which IP address, supporting forensic investigation if needed.
- Role-Based Access Controls: Granular permission settings that limit document access based on organizational roles, particularly important for Houston’s larger enterprises with complex hierarchies.
Houston businesses must navigate a complex compliance landscape that includes federal regulations like ESIGN (Electronic Signatures in Global and National Commerce Act) and UETA (Uniform Electronic Transactions Act), as well as industry-specific requirements such as HIPAA for healthcare, 21 CFR Part 11 for life sciences, and SOC 2 for technology services. Advanced digital signature solutions provide compliance features that address these requirements, often with pre-configured templates and workflows specific to Houston’s prominent industries. 1. What’s the difference between electronic signatures and digital signatures?
Electronic signatures and digital signatures, while often used interchangeably, represent different levels of security and verification. Electronic signatures are broadly defined as any electronic mark indicating signing intent, which could include a typed name, checked box, or basic signature image. Digital signatures, however, utilize cryptographic technology with public key infrastructure (PKI) to create a secure, verifiable signature that provides stronger authentication, greater security, and better evidence of signing intent. Digital signatures include encryption that verifies both signer identity and document integrity, making them more suitable for high-value transactions and regulated industries common in Houston’s business environment. Most enterprise solutions offer both options, allowing organizations to apply the appropriate level of security based on the document’s importance and compliance requirements.
2. Are digital signatures legally binding in Texas?
Yes, digital signatures are legally binding in Texas under both federal and state laws. Texas has adopted the Uniform Electronic Transactions Act (UETA) and complies with the federal Electronic Signatures in Global and National Commerce Act (ESIGN), which establish the legal validity of electronic signatures. These laws specify that signatures cannot be denied legal effect solely because they are in electronic form. However, certain document types have special requirements or exclusions, including wills, certain family law documents, and some real estate transactions. Houston businesses should consult with legal counsel to ensure their specific implementation meets all applicable requirements, particularly for regulated industries with additional compliance considerations. Proper implementation with strong authentication, clear consent processes, and comprehensive audit trails strengthens the legal enforceability of digitally signed documents.
